The physical and chemical erosion resistance of refractories is mainly determined by the type, distribution and bonding state of their constituent phases. General refractories are composed of one or more crystalline phases, glass phases and gas phases (pores). Glass is less chemically stable than crystal, and pores are channels (especially open pores) through which the erosive agent penetrates into the interior of refractories. The corroder first acts on the glass phase in the refractory, reacting with each other. After the solution penetrates into the refractory and melts the glass phase, the crystal in the refractory will be eroded by the glass liquid, and it is possible to continuously appear and continue to be eroded by the new part. Porosity and glass phase are mostly present in the binder of sintered refractory, so the binder becomes the weak link of resistance to physical and chemical erosion of refractory.
Now large furnaces mostly use bubble clarification technology, in order to improve the melting rate, but also strengthen the convection of glass liquid, increase the temperature of deep glass liquid, but also strengthen the erosion of refractory materials.
When adding the table material to the furnace, the powder is easy to be taken away by the flowing gas in the furnace, and the dust contains a lot of alkali, which is often deposited on the upper surface of the pool wall brick to generate glaze, and flows down along the surface of the brick, so that the brick surface forms a deep groove, and even drops in the glass liquid, causing the glass liquid to produce stripes and other defects.
The superstructure of furnace is often eroded by compound dust and volatiles. But the dust and refractory chemical reaction, the product is left on the surface of refractory material, forming a layer of film, has a protective effect, can prevent the further erosion of refractory material with material dust.
